Measurement of Soil Resistivity
The soil resistivity is the geological and physical quantity for calculation and design of
earthing systems. The measuring procedure shown in Figure 11 uses the method
developed by Wenner (F. Wenner, A method of measuring earth resistivity; Bull. National
Bureau of Standards, Bulletin 12 (4), Paper 258, S 478-496; 1915/16).

Figure 11. Measurement of Soil Resistivity
1. Four earth spikes of the same length are positioned into the soil in an even line and
with the same distance "a" to each other. The earth spikes should not be deeper than
a maximum of 1/3 of "a".
2. Turn central rotary switch to position "R
E
4pole".
The instrument is to be wired according to picture and notices given on the display.
A flashing of the sockets symbols  or , points to an incorrect or
incomplete connection of the measuring lead.
3. Push "START TEST" button.
